Episode Notes In what has been described on Twitter as the “doing your own taxes of medicine,” Drs. Emily Heil (@emilylheil) and Andrew Fratoni (@AFratty) join Dr. Jillian Hayes (@thejillianhayes) to break down the ins and outs of sulfamethoxazole/trimethoprim dosing! Tune in for a discussion on the use of this agent for meth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us, gram-negatives, pneumocystis, and Stenotrophomonas maltophilia.
